Seems you were right. Just checked in the manual and it does say you can connect any two of the following motors to one speed controller: seat motor, window lift motor, 12 Vdc LEDs (yes, these are allowed though why you'd want to speed control an LED beats me -- yes, I realize they're are applications but not for the robot). I just read the part about no more than one of the drill, fisher-price, globe or van door motor can be powered by a single speed control and assumed that included everything.
